Representative Court, chair, called the meeting to order. A quorum was present.



10:02 AM -- HB16-1044



Representative Becker, J. introduced House Bill 16-1044. The bill extends two repeal dates related to the Petroleum Storage Tank Funk by five years. First, the bill extends to September 1, 2023, from July 1, 2018, a trigger that would reduce the environmental response surcharge assessment to a flat $25, or eliminate it entirely if the fund balance exceed $8 million. Second, the bill extends to September 1, 2023, from July 1, 2018, the law authorizing the use of the fund for petroleum storage tank facility inspections and meter calibrations.
